Bromsgrove Minor Injuries Unit Monday to Friday: 8am-8pm Saturday and Sunday: 12pm-8pm We have seven community hospitals/rehab units across Worcestershire. They provide a range of inpatient and outpatient services and support people to recovery from surgery or illness when they don't require acute care but neither can they be treated at home. General information: View patient 'Welcome Pack' Lickey Ward - A 24 bedding ward, supporting patients requiring continued care after a stay in an acute hospital. The ward has a particular focus on rehabilitation and frailty. Cottage Ward - A 28 bedded ward that completes assessments and rehabilitation of the older person with varying health and care needs. The ward aims to support a timely discharge by completing and carrying out therapy led assessments with nursing care intervention to facilitate a smooth discharge process. The Primrose Unit at The Princess of Wales Community Hospital is a six bedded (single occupancy) NHS Specialist Palliative Care ward, staffed entirely by nurses and led by a full time Specialist Consultant in Palliative Medicine and Clinical Nurse Specialist/Ward Manager.
